This part includes a NGCatcher sequence BBa_K4119013 and bcd gene (BBa_K4119027) derived from Clostridium tyrobutyricum (C. tyrobutyricum) L319. It codes a fusion protein of NGCatcher and butyryl-CoA dehydrogenase (bcd). bcd gene codes for butyryl-CoA dehydrogenase which converts crotonyl-CoA to butyryl-CoA in the butyrate synthesis pathway in C. tyrobutyricum. NGTag/NGCatcher peptides are variants of the SpyTag/SpyCatcher system and are reported to be useful for peptide-peptide interaction for multienzyme assembly. NGCatcher has a high density of negative charge on its surface and is a highly charged protein. It forms a covalent bond through an isopeptide bond with NGTag rapidly which is not affected by the change of environment. The fusion protein of NGCatcher and butyryl-CoA dehydrogenase can be assembled with another enzyme fused with NGTag.
